Following my other efforts in recent months to help Dereham councillors and residents concerned about the proposed Orbit Homes application for up to 284 homes on land off Greenfields Road in Dereham, I wrote to Breckland Council this past Friday to reiterate my concerns about the development (see below).

My letter was read out in support of the local community at yesterday’s Planning Committee hearing and I am pleased to report that the application was not granted permission.

Instead, the Planning Committee have deferred the application so that Orbit can re-engineer the scheme – in order to be make it more acceptable to the local community.

Planning Committee Chairman, Cllr Nigel Wilkin, told Orbit: “Work with the community. This will always be Orbit’s development and if you work with your community and get it right you will be praised for it.”

I remain committed to supporting the local community to help achieve a resolution that works for them.
